Neil Leslie Diamond, who was born in Brooklyn, New York, back in 1941, developed a profound passion for music early. He actually began his career by crafting songs for other artists, diligently honing his unique skills and distinct craft. This unwavering dedication laid the essential groundwork for his eventual and well-deserved superstar status.

His formative years were deeply rooted within a working-class environment, which significantly influenced his unique perspectives and poignant lyrical themes. Neil notably attended Abraham Lincoln High School right alongside future legendary singer Barbra Streisand, an interesting connection. He briefly pursued studies at New York University before making the courageous decision to drop out and fully pursue songwriting. This bold and determined choice proved to be a pivotal turning point for his artistic and enduring future.

Neil's momentous breakthrough truly arrived during the vibrant mid-1960s with iconic hits such as "Solitary Man" and "Cherry, Cherry" captivating audiences. These incredibly catchy tunes brilliantly showcased his innovative blend of engaging pop, energetic rock, and heartfelt folk influences. His compelling storytelling abilities and powerful vocal delivery resonated deeply with listeners across the globe. He very quickly established himself as a formidable and exceptionally talented solo recording artist.

Throughout the dynamic 1970s, Neil Diamond definitively solidified his esteemed place as a genuine global music icon. His acclaimed live albums, particularly "Hot August Night," brilliantly captured the electrifying energy and magic of his stage performances. Iconic anthems, especially "Sweet Caroline," rapidly became beloved sing-along staples at countless concerts and major sporting events. His prolific songwriting talent consistently yielded a remarkable string of chart-topping hits and universally cherished ballads.

His extensive list of achievements is genuinely remarkable, including multiple prestigious Grammy nominations and a well-deserved Lifetime Achievement Award in 2018. Neil was justly inducted into both the esteemed Songwriters Hall of Fame and the revered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. These significant accolades serve to recognize his profound and lasting impact on the landscape of popular music. He has impressively sold over 100 million records worldwide, a clear testament to his enduring and widespread appeal.

Concerning his most recent updates, in 2018, Neil bravely announced his diagnosis of Parkinson's disease, which ultimately led to his retirement from active touring. However, his creative spirit and passion for music remain vibrantly alive and extremely strong. He continues to respectfully engage with his devoted fans and periodically releases new musical material for their enjoyment. A highly anticipated biographical musical, aptly titled "A Beautiful Noise," successfully opened on Broadway, celebrating his extraordinary life and legendary career. This significant project beautifully keeps his profound musical legacy alive for an entirely new generation of admirers.

What is Neil Diamond's most famous song?

"Sweet Caroline" is widely considered Neil Diamond's most famous and beloved song. Released in 1969, it has become an iconic anthem frequently played at sporting events, parties, and gatherings worldwide. Its catchy chorus and uplifting melody have cemented its place in popular culture forever.

When was Neil Diamond in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ame?

Neil Diamond was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2011. This prestigious honor recognized his significant contributions to music as a singer, songwriter, and performer. His induction cemented his legacy as one of the most influential artists of his generation, celebrated for decades of hits.
